Actually they introduced some stupidity where if you proxy a pylon into their base, they'll worker charge it. If your probe is still around and draws some attention, they'll chase it too. If you send the probe in a huge shift-circle around the map, three of the comps workers will chase it until the end of time. This is mostly useful in that it's repeatable (I had 12 comp workers following 4 of my workers around the map) and they also ignore the building if they've chased the probe away. | ||

On September 23 2010 01:27 Djeez wrote: Well, I can't be sure if it's worth a mention, but the Insane AI got improved. For the grinders out there, it is now harder to just cannon rush the computer in 3 minutes and win, since they go apeshit as soon as you build something on their platform. You have to begin at the bottom of the ramp, now. I can confirm that just before the patch, you could build pylon+forge+cannons on the platform without getting attacked (unless you were way too close). I cant tell whether to like this change cause its more challenging or hate it because it means I have to grind 2X as long to get my 250 achieve. Soooooo glad I got the 15 win streak insane out of the way :p | ||
